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age, identifying the source of the leak and the extent of the water damage. We’ll develop a customized plan to address the issue, which may include extracting water, drying out the property, and repairing or replacing damaged materials.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. Our team will carefully remove standing water, saturating materials, and moisture from walls, floors, and ceilings.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This step is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ring that your property is saf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Our team will repair or replace dam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and ceilings. We’ll work to match the original materials and finishes, so your property looks like new again.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control
We’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ure that your property is restored to its pre-loss condition. Our team will verify that all work is complete, and that your property is safe and secure.

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air
Catching these warning sign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the signs of water damage – it’s not just a cosmetic issue, it’s a safety hazard.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. These substances can cause serious health problems, especially for people with respiratory issues. Don’t ignore the smell – it’s a sign that you need professional help.
Warped or Discolored Ceilings
Warped or discolored ceilings can show water damage or leaks. Don’t assume it’s just a minor issue – it could be a sign of a bigger problem.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ains can show leaks or water damage. Don’t ignore the stains – they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or moisture issues. Don’t assume it’s just a cosmetic issue – it could be a sign of a bigger problem.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can show water damage or moisture issues. Don’t ignore the mold – it can cause serious health problems.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ost In Indian Hills, CO
The cost of Ceiling Water Damage Repair can vary widely, dep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Indian Hills, CO. Our team will provide a free estimate to help you understand the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, amount of moisture, and equipment needed. |
| Repair and rest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and complexity of repairs. |
| Final inspection and quality control |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of repairs. |
